Stephen Hargadon’s short stories have appeared in Black Static, Tales from the Shadow Booth, Crimewave, Structo, Popshot, Cafe Stories, the Irish Post, and LossLit. His non-fiction has featured on the Litro website (including a well-received article on the joys of secondhand bookshops) and he has written on short fiction for Thresholds, the international short story forum.
- Runner-up, Dinesh Allirajah prize for short fiction, 2018 (Comma Press & UCLan). ‘The Lull’ was published in the competition anthology, Cafe Stories.
- Shortlisted for the 2017 Observer/Anthony Burgess prize for Arts Journalism
- Runner-up, Irish Post Short Story Competition, 2016
He lives in the north of England.
